Brake System Repairs
While frequently disregarded, brake system repairs are essential for maintaining vehicle safety and performance. Regular inspections are crucial, as worn brake pads can weaken stopping power and create dangerous situations. Mechanics advise checking brake fluid levels, as low fluid can signal leaks or other issues within the system. In addition, brake rotors should be checked for warping or scoring, which can produce uneven braking and increased wear on pads. Drivers should also be attentive to unusual noises, such as grinding or squeaking, as these may signify the need for immediate attention. By addressing brake system repairs immediately, vehicle owners can confirm their cars remain safe and reliable on the road, ultimately enhancing both performance and longevity.

What Can You Expect During Your Auto Service Appointment?
While arranging an auto service appointment, many car owners question what to expect during the visit. Generally, the process begins with a check-in, where the service advisor obtains information about the vehicle's symptoms and any specific concerns the owner may have. Subsequently, the vehicle undergoes an initial inspection to evaluate its condition.
After this, the technicians perform a range of diagnostics, which may entail scanning the vehicle's computer systems and conducting physical inspections. According to the findings, the consultant will go over necessary repairs or maintenance with the customer, providing estimates on fees and timeframes.
Once approved, the mechanics carry out the needed work, whether it's scheduled maintenance or repairs. When the service is complete, the vehicle is cleaned, and the owner is briefed on the work carried out. Payment is finalized, and any extra recommendations for future maintenance are offered, guaranteeing the car remains in optimal condition.

How Frequently Should I Have My Tires Rotated?
Tire rotation should occur every five thousand to seven thousand five hundred miles, depending on driving conditions and vehicle type. Routine rotation ensures even tire wear, prolonging tire life and optimizing performance for enhanced road safety.

How Should I Respond if My Check Engine Light Is On?
When the check engine light illuminates, the initial step is to inspect a loose or improperly secured gas cap, then proceed to scan the vehicle for error codes. Seeking professional diagnosis may be necessary to guarantee the issue is properly resolved.
